The Case for Editing Your Beauty Shelf

A shorter lineup of beauty products isn’t just about doing less. It could be about giving each product a chance to earn shelf space. When a shelf gets crowded with things picked up out of habit, it gets harder to know what’s helping and what’s only taking up valuable counter space.

Growth factor skincare derived from plants fits neatly into that shift, built around just a few of the most effective ingredients rather than a long list of extras. A deliberate routine may only need a cleanser, serum, and face cream to start.

About BIOEFFECT

BIOEFFECT is an Icelandic skincare brand with a breakthrough ingredient backed by science: plant-derived Epidermal Growth Factor (EGF) produced in barley. With potent products made with only pure, clean ingredients, BIOEFFECT stays true to its goal of helping people maintain visibly healthier skin.
